FYI- the zip code tells postal services everything they need to know for sorting purposes; the "City/State" is redundant and is usually just used to double-check, so this technicality doesn't matter as long as you list the correct DC zip code and street address.
 
Do all transcripts need to be sent with a "Transcript Request Form" generated from AMCAS? Or is this just for the senders that don't have an electronic system?
 
Thanks guys. I'm guess I'll list Washington as the city and DC as the state. I guess I'm overthinking too much. And from what I know, not all transcripts need to be sent with a request form. Only those schools that are approved senders of eTranscripts don't need a request form, as their online system can accommodate your AAMC and AMCAS transcript ID #. If there's no option to list your ID #'s, then I would say send in the request form with the official paper transcript.
